The Pioneer CDJ 1000 MK3 is the industry standard for professional DJ. Fully equipped for the future of digital DJing and inspired by the input of world-renown DJs, the ingenious Pioneer CDJ 1000 MK3 houses a host of refined ‘feel-good’ features.

Combining convenient MP3 compatibility, a fast folder search facility, enhanced presentation of track/wave data and an improved jog wheel with adjustable traction, the MK3s are designed to deliver the most advantageous digital DJ experience.

As a DJ you don’t want to have to learn how to use a new deck at every gig. The Pioneer CDJ 1000 MK3 stays focussed on the job in hand and ultimately wins on practicality and ease of use.

It’s a front-loading CD player (plays audio CDs and MP3 data CDs) with a familiar tempo/pitch slider where you’d expect to find it, allowing independent adjustments to playback speed and pitch. Transport controls are on the left, with the main Play/Pause and Cue buttons picked out with backlighting.

One very handy feature is the ability to save cue points to SD card – keep your SD cards with your CDs and you only need to set up the cue points once, rather than every time you rock up at a new venue.
